Search a number
-
+
3399249984 = 263131361879
BaseRepresentation
bin1100101010011100…
…0111000001000000
322202220021210100120
43022213013001000
523430201444414
61321145420240
7150144101544
oct31247070100
98686253316
103399249984
111494873909
127aa49a680
13422322630
14243653a24
1514d65a2a9
hexca9c7040

3399249984 has 56 divisors (see below), whose sum is σ = 9685690560. Its totient is φ = 1045922304.

The previous prime is 3399249979. The next prime is 3399249989. The reversal of 3399249984 is 4899429933.

It is an interprime number because it is at equal distance from previous prime (3399249979) and next prime (3399249989).

It is not an unprimeable number, because it can be changed into a prime (3399249989) by changing a digit.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 678444 + ... + 683435.

It is an arithmetic number, because the mean of its divisors is an integer number (172958760).

Almost surely, 23399249984 is an apocalyptic number.

It is an amenable number.

3399249984 is an abundant number, since it is smaller than the sum of its proper divisors (6286440576).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

3399249984 is a wasteful number, since it uses less digits than its factorization.

3399249984 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 1361907 (or 1361897 counting only the distinct ones).

The product of its digits is 15116544, while the sum is 60.

The square root of 3399249984 is about 58303.0872595954. The cubic root of 3399249984 is about 1503.5840199359.

The spelling of 3399249984 in words is "three billion, three hundred ninety-nine million, two hundred forty-nine thousand, nine hundred eighty-four".

Divisors: 1 2 3 4 6 8 12 13 16 24 26 32 39 48 52 64 78 96 104 156 192 208 312 416 624 832 1248 2496 1361879 2723758 4085637 5447516 8171274 10895032 16342548 17704427 21790064 32685096 35408854 43580128 53113281 65370192 70817708 87160256 106226562 130740384 141635416 212453124 261480768 283270832 424906248 566541664 849812496 1133083328 1699624992 3399249984